If the greatest common factor of two or more numbers is 1, then they are
\relatively prime.
\Greatest common factor (GCF) is a number that is greatest among the
\common factors of the numbers.
List the factors of each number.
\Factors of 34 : 2, 17, 34
\Factors of 38 : 2, 19, 38
\Identify the greatest common factor.
\The greatest common factor of 34 and 38 is 2.
\Since the GCF is not 1, 34 and 38 are not relatively prime.
